When you are ready to restart your life, then it is imperative that you find a detoxification program to start your recovery today. The length of time that someone need at a detoxification center can vary severely depending on your drug of of choice and length of their addiction. In general it is advised that you go through a drug detox program before they attend an inpatient treatment facility. Attending a detoxification program significantlyincrease a person likliehood of attaining sobriety. Deciding on a treatment facility that will look at your specific needs is very essential. Where you go to rehab is entirely something you may went help deciding. Permanent recovery is completely possible wherever you are. The most imperative step is taking action right now. If you go to a rehab around home then you are around by support and love, however you are also around to old people and places that may lessen your of staying sober. If you visit a rehab further away you could have a stronger chance to make a fresh start and form a support group to help you stay sober. The most essential choice that you should make is that you are ready to get help and change your life.
